Binance Alpha’s recent listing activities have come under examination following claims that Tell A Tale (TAT) was added on March 22, 2025. Current credible sources do not verify this addition, signaling potential discrepancies with the information.
The alleged addition of TAT is notable because it contrasts against recent verifiable announcements from Binance. Lack of official confirmation suggests uncertainty surrounding these claims.
Unverified Claims of TAT Listing Spark Industry Debate
The addition of TAT to Binance Alpha has not been substantiated by primary sources or official Binance announcements. Reports circulated that TAT was included on March 22, 2025, as part of Binance Alpha’s listings. However, the claim misses validation from Binance, which earlier confirmed new tokens—AIFlow Token (AFT), BNB Card, Mubarakah, and Plume (PLUME)—on March 21.
This inconsistency raises crucial concerns regarding the validity of token listing information. Without direct confirmation from Binance, doubts persist about the accuracy of the March 22 report. The absence of corroboration suggests possible inaccuracies.
